Product Description
"It is reckoned that up to 2.6 million adults in the UK alone suffer from depression, and that it costs the economy in the region of £9billion pounds per annum both in treatment and in lost work days. And yet, most people don't really understand what depression is, what the difference between depression and 'feeling a little blue' or what the symptoms are. This is a subject I'm absolutely passionate about. When I was a medical student, I became depressed and ended up in hospital myself. I learned a lot and have tried all the ideas in this book, can vouch for them and have seen them work for many of my patients."
Dr Sabina Dosani
What it's about
Depression is greatly misunderstood. Those that admit to suffering from it very often feel ashamed. Those that have never suffered from it think it's all a matter of "getting a grip". Here for the first time is a book written by a psychiatrist which offers a full understanding of the condition and practical, tried and tested techniques to help overcome it. Whether for you, or someone close to you who suffers, Defeat depression will prove invaluable. Sabina reveals:
The importance of a good night's sleep
How to raise your self-esteem
Ten foods for good moods
The pills and potions to avoid and those that work Who can help you beat the blues
Nature's best anti-depressants
How self-help and group therapy can work for you

About the Author
Dr Sabina Dosani is a Child and Adolescent Psychiatrist at the Maudsley Hospital, London. She has training and experience helping adults and young people overcome a range of psychiatric problems.
